It all over-cooks.
We find that overnight we can make:
Cholent
Short grain brown rice and meat (no other rice holds up)
Yapsuk
Pastrami only if it's raw and still left in the vacuum sealed bag - with bag submerged in a crockpot full of cold water and turned on low at the start of shabbos (delicious if served right away on a board- but don't expect nice slices or for leftovers to go over well)
No matter what you try, avoid sauces especially honey and BBQ sauce, as they give anything you try overnight an over-cooked burnt taste.

Turkey neck soup
Put turkey necks and vegetables into the crock pot. Potato, sweet potato, celery, carrots. Cover with water. Season with what spices you like, or onion soup mix if you like that.
Cook on low from candle lighting til lunch.
